Chateau Dereszla, Dry Furmint

Furmint – pronounced “four-mint” so nothing to do with a lost Polo found at the bottom of a coat pocket… unless you have more than 3 of them – is one of the principle grape varieties of the famous sweet wine of Hungary: Tokaji (rhymes with “och aye”).

Rather than when making sweet Tokaji, Furmint grapes are harvested earlier, before the famous noble rot that creates the sweet wine, and all of the natural sugars are allowed to ferment into alcohol. The result is a dry wine with some of the depth (and just a hint of residual sugar) that characterises its more famous counterpart.

 

Plenty of rich spicy apricot fruit and lovely mineral freshness, this wine is produced using hand-harvested grapes from vines planted on the volcanic soils of the Lapis vineyard. It’s a great match for paté and warm crusty bread or mushroom dishes such as Mushroom Stroganoff. It’s also great with smoked fish.
